Choosing a Reliable Tradesperson (and Avoid Cowboy Builders)

Finding a reliable tradesperson shouldn’t feel like playing the lottery. Whether it’s a burst pipe at midnight or a dodgy socket sparking trouble, you need someone who knows their stuff, turns up when they say they will, and doesn’t charge you an arm and a leg.

What to Look for in a Reliable Tradesperson

  1. Proper Certification & Insurance – If they can’t prove they’re qualified, walk away. Gas engineers must be Gas Safe registered, and electricians should be NICEIC approved.
  2. Local & Established – A solid track record and local reputation are worth more than a flashy website. Ask for recommendations from neighbours or check reviews online (Google & Trustpilot).
  3. Clear Pricing, No Hidden Costs – A vague quote that “might change” afterwards is a red flag. Get it in writing.
  4. Emergency Response Time – When it’s urgent, you don’t want to be waiting hours. Check they offer a genuine 24/7 service.
  5. Guarantees & Warranties – A reliable tradesperson guarantees their work. If they won’t guarantee it, that’s a problem.

Red Flags to Watch Out For

  • Cash-only deals with no paperwork.
  • Reluctance to provide references or proof of qualifications.
  • Quotes that are too cheap to be true (they probably are).
  • No physical address or verified contact details.
